The Connection Between Herbs and Heart Health

Herbs have been used for millennia to promote health and treat diseases. They contain potent compounds that can positively affect heart health. Antioxidants, anti-inflammatory compounds, and heart-healthy fats are some of the beneficial properties found in herbs. By combating oxidative stress, reducing inflammation, and promoting healthy blood lipid levels, these herbs can significantly contribute to heart health.

Top Herbs for Heart Health

1. Garlic

Garlic is a potent herb with numerous health benefits. It’s known to lower cholesterol, reduce blood pressure, and prevent blood clots, contributing to overall heart health.

2. Hawthorn

Hawthorn is a powerful heart tonic. It strengthens the heart muscles, enhances blood flow, and also helps in maintaining healthy blood pressure levels.

3. Green Tea

Rich in antioxidants, green tea protects against oxidative stress, a common culprit in heart disease. It also helps in maintaining healthy blood pressure and cholesterol levels.

4. Turmeric

Curcumin, the active ingredient in turmeric, is a powerful anti-inflammatory agent. It can help reduce inflammation, a critical factor in heart disease.

5. Gingko Biloba

Gingko biloba improves blood flow and has antioxidant properties, making it beneficial for heart health.

6. Flaxseed

Flaxseeds are rich in omega-3 fatty acids, which are beneficial for heart health. They help reduce inflammation and maintain healthy cholesterol levels.

7. Others

Herbs like ginger, cayenne, and rosemary also offer heart health benefits.

Understanding the Limitations and Side Effects

While herbs can contribute significantly to heart health, they should not replace medical treatments for heart conditions. Always consult with healthcare professionals before starting any herbal regimen. Some herbs may interact with medications and may have side effects, so professional guidance is crucial.
